Gyroscope is described as 'Lets you automatically track and share your life. Gyroscope integrates with all the fitness trackers and apps you're already using' and is a Habit Tracker in the sport & health category. There are more than 25 alternatives to Gyroscope for a variety of platforms, including iPhone, Android, iPad, Web-based and Android Tablet apps. The best Gyroscope alternative is Exist. It's not free, so if you're looking for a free alternative, you could try Kyugo or Everyday. Other great apps like Gyroscope are Ohms: Understand Your Data, Commit: Everyday Consistency, OffScreen and Arc Timeline - Trips & Places.
